Transaction f8081476e64f7929db741eecb80570e59ab6264fc1f809d6a3f95d72d613b578

47 Input
2 Outputs
  • f8081476e64f7929db741eecb80570e59ab6264fc1f809d6a3f95d72d613b578:0
  • value  2500000000
    address  3EpyhpDRu2wz5LtS4sPAmXaGozuxYWdRkN
  • f8081476e64f7929db741eecb80570e59ab6264fc1f809d6a3f95d72d613b578:1
  • value  1448082744
    address  1AQLXAB6aXSVbRMjbhSBudLf1kcsbWSEjg